Job Description:
Under general supervision, staff Wellness Center during scheduled programming hours and/or provide instruction for structured classes (art, gardening, etc.) upon approval by supervisor.
This is a temporary (not to exceed 960 hours), un-benefitted, part-time Wellness Center Associate. Incumbents learn and perform to host a variety of wellness programs. Incumbents will be trained and perform as ambassadors to Mono County Behavioral Health services by educating the public at outreach events and wellness programming on the services Mono County Behavioral Health offers to Mono County residents.
Examples of Job Duties:
• Open Wellness Center for specific hours.
• Refer any person inquiring about mental health and/or substance use services to our offices located in Mammoth Lakes.
• Maintain and clean facilities between programming.
• Provide class(es)—after approval from supervisor
• Keep Wellness Calendar current and up to date.
• Create and distribute programming flyers.
• Collect required documentation and record per department protocol.
Qualifications:
Knowledge of:
• Services provided by Mono County Behavioral Health and other County departments and local organizations
• Peer support for people living with mental illness
• Customer service skills
• General computer skills
Ability to:
• Make proper referrals to MCBH and/or other county agencies
• Triage “walk-in” requests
• Manage groups of people for class activities
• Follow all county, department, building and Wellness Center rules and regulations
• Communicate effectively and respectfully with the public
• Initiate and maintain required documentation
Other Information:
TYPICAL P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:
Sit for extended periods; frequently stand and walk; normal manual dexterity and eye-hand coordination; corrected hearing and vision to normal range; verbal communication; use of audio-visual equipment; use of office equipment including computers, telephones, calculators, copiers, and FAX.
TYPICAL WORKING CONDITIONS:
Work is performed in an office or field environment; frequent contact with staff and the public.
Special Requirements:
• Possession of a valid CA driver’s license;
• May work other than a normal 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. shift.
